Search Engine Optimization (SEO) is the practice of enhancing your website’s visibility and relevance on search engines like Google and Bing. It encompasses three key areas: off-page, on-page, and technical optimization. Technical SEO audit plays a crucial role in ensuring that your website meets the technical requirements set by search engines, improving its overall performance and ranking.
- Off-Page SEO: involves activities outside your website, such as link building and social media marketing, to improve your site’s authority and relevance.
- On-Page SEO: Involves optimizing elements within your web pages, such as titles, headings, meta tags, URLs, and internal links.
- Technical SEO: Ensures that your website is easily crawlable, indexable, and ranks well by addressing technical aspects like site speed, mobile-friendliness, structured data, and security.
In our comprehensive guide on Technical SEO audit, we’ll delve into the importance of technical optimization, conduct audits, and provide practical solutions for common issues.
By the end, you’ll be equipped to enhance your website’s performance and visibility in search results.
What is Technical SEO?
Technical SEO is the process of optimizing the technical aspects of your website that affect its performance, usability, and accessibility. Technical SEO does not involve the content or the design of your website, but rather the behind-the-scenes factors that influence how search engines and users interact with your website.
Some of the main components of Technical SEO are:
- Site speed: how fast your website loads on different devices and browsers.
- Mobile-friendliness: how well your website adapts to different screen sizes and resolutions.
- Structured data: how you use schema markup to provide additional information about your website and its content to search engines.
- Canonical tags: how you avoid duplicate content issues by specifying the preferred version of a web page.
- Sitemaps: how you provide a map of your website’s structure and content to search engines.
- Robots.txt: how you control which pages and resources of your website are accessible to search engines and which are not.
- SSL certificates: how you secure the connection between your website and its visitors.
Why is Technical SEO Important?
Technical SEO is important because it affects the user experience, the crawlability, and indexability of your website. User experience is the overall impression and satisfaction that your visitors have when they interact with your website.
User Experience (UX):
- Technical SEO directly impacts how visitors perceive and interact with your website.
- A poorly optimized site can frustrate users, increase bounce rates, and harm overall satisfaction.
Crawlability:
- Search engines need to access and explore your site effectively.
- If crawlability is hindered (e.g., due to slow loading times or broken links), it affects search engine visibility.
Indexability:
- Search engines must understand and store your site’s content.
- Good technical SEO ensures proper indexing, while issues (like duplicate content) can confuse search engines.
Positive vs. Negative Impact:
- Poor Technical SEO: Slower site, non-mobile-friendly design, duplicate content, broken links.
- Good Technical SEO: Faster site, mobile-friendly, structured data, sitemaps.
In summary, technical SEO is crucial for a user-friendly, search engine-friendly, and rank-worthy website!
How to Conduct a Technical SEO Audit?
A technical SEO audit can be a complex and time-consuming process, depending on the size and complexity of your website. However, it is a worthwhile investment that can help you improve your website’s performance, usability, and accessibility, and ultimately, your SEO results.
To conduct a technical SEO audit, you need to use various tools and methods to evaluate different aspects of your website’s technical SEO. Some of the most common tools and methods are:
Common Tools and Methods for Technical SEO Audits:
- Google Search Console: A free tool by Google that monitors and troubleshoots your site’s presence on Google Search. It provides insights into coverage, performance, speed, and mobile usability.
- Google Analytics: Another free Google tool that measures website traffic, behavior, and conversions. It tracks loading time, bounce rate, sessions, and pageviews.
- Google PageSpeed Insights: Assesses your site’s speed on desktop and mobile devices, offering recommendations for improvement.
- Google Mobile-Friendly Test: Verifies how well your site adapts to mobile devices, providing pass/fail results and screenshots.
- Google Structured Data Testing Tool: Validates your site’s structured data (schema markup) for errors or warnings.
- Screaming Frog SEO Spider: A paid tool for crawling and analyzing URLs, titles, meta tags, headings, and links.
- Moz Pro Site Crawl: a paid tool that allows you to crawl and audit your website’s technical SEO. You can use Moz Pro Site Crawl to check your site’s crawlability, indexability, content quality, site speed, and more.
Remember, regular technical audits are essential for maintaining a healthy website and improving search engine rankings.
Common Technical SEO Issues and Solutions
In this section, we will discuss some of the most common technical SEO issues that can affect your website’s health, functionality, and visibility, and how to fix them.
Site Speed:
- Importance: Site speed significantly impacts both user experience and SEO.
- Issues: A slow website frustrates visitors, increases bounce rates, and reduces conversions. It also affects your crawl budget (the number of pages search engines can index within a timeframe).
Solutions:
- Minify Files: Remove unnecessary code, comments, spaces, and characters from HTML, CSS, and JavaScript files to reduce their size.
- Image Compression: Compress images without compromising quality using tools like TinyPNG or ImageOptim.
- Caching: Enable caching to store copies of files on your server or visitors’ browsers, reducing requests and improving loading time (use plugins like WP Rocket or W3 Total Cache).
- CDN: Use a content delivery network (CDN) to distribute files globally for faster delivery (services like Cloudflare or Amazon CloudFront).
- Upgrade Hosting: Choose a reliable, fast web hosting provider with sufficient resources.
No HTTPS Security:
- Issue: Lack of HTTPS security can deter users and negatively impact rankings.
- Solution: Obtain an SSL certificate from a Certificate Authority to secure your site.
Incorrect Indexing:
- Issue: If your pages aren’t indexed, they won’t appear in search results.
- Solution: Check indexation by typing “site:yoursitename.com” in Google search. Ensure proper indexing.
No XML Sitemaps:
- Issue: Missing XML sitemaps hinder search engines from understanding your site’s structure.
- Solution: Create and submit XML sitemaps to search engines.
Robots.txt Issues:
- Issue: Incorrect or missing robots.txt files can impact crawling and indexing.
- Solution: Ensure your robots.txt file is correctly configured.
Duplicate Content:
- Issue: Duplicate content confuses search engines and affects rankings.
- Solution: Identify and address duplicate content issues.
Missing Alt Tags:
- Issue: Images without alt tags hinder accessibility and SEO.
- Solution: Add descriptive alt tags to images.
Broken Links:
- Issue: Broken links harm user experience and SEO.
- Solution: Regularly check and fix broken links.
Structured Data:
- Issue: Insufficient use of structured data affects rich snippets and visibility.
- Solution: Implement structured data markup for better search results.
Remember, addressing these technical SEO issues enhances your website’s health, functionality, and visibility.
Mobile-friendliness
Mobile-friendliness is important for user experience and SEO. It means your website adapts to different screens and resolutions and offers easy and smooth navigation for mobile users. It can attract more visitors and rank higher on mobile search results.
To achieve mobile-friendliness, use a responsive or adaptive design. A responsive website design uses the same code and URL for all devices but changes the layout and content based on the screen size. An adaptive design uses different codes and URLs for different devices and delivers a customized website based on the device type.
Some best practices for mobile-friendliness are:
- Use a mobile-friendly theme or framework, such as Bootstrap, Foundation, or Genesis.
- Test your website on different devices and browsers, using tools like Google’s Mobile-Friendly Test, BrowserStack, or Chrome DevTools. Use Google’s PageSpeed Insights to measure your website’s speed and performance on mobile devices.
- Optimize your images and videos, using tools like TinyPNG, Compress JPEG, or HandBrake. Use responsive images and videos that fit the screen size and resolution of the device.
- Simplify your navigation and layout, using clear and concise menus, buttons, and links that are easy to tap on a small screen. Use collapsible menus, hamburger icons, or swipe gestures to save space and improve usability. Use a simple and consistent layout that avoids clutter, pop-ups, and excessive scrolling.
Structured Data and Canonical Tags:
Structured data (or schema markup) helps search engines understand your content better. It provides additional context about elements like products, events, recipes, and reviews. Use canonical tags to prevent duplicate content issues. Specify the preferred version of a page to avoid indexing multiple variations.
Sitemaps and Robots.txt:
XML sitemaps guide search engines by listing important pages on your site. Submit them to search engines for efficient crawling. Robots.txt controls which pages search engine bots can access. Be cautious not to block essential pages.
Choosing the Right Technical SEO Tools:
Select the right tools to streamline your technical SEO efforts:
- Keyword Research Tools: Understand user intent and target relevant keywords.
- Crawling Tools: Identify crawl errors, broken links, and duplicate content.
- Performance Monitoring Tools: Track site speed, uptime, and user experience.
The Role of SSL Certificates:
Secure Sockets Layer (SSL) certificates encrypt data transmitted between users and your website. Google considers SSL a ranking signal. Ensure your site uses HTTPS for enhanced security and trust.
Conclusion: Navigating the Future of Technical SEO:
Technical SEO is ongoing. Stay updated, adapt to changes, and refine your website’s backstage. At Out Origin, we specialize in comprehensive technical SEO audits. Let us be your backstage crew, ensuring your website shines on the digital stage!
FAQS:
-
What is the impact of site speed on SEO?
Site speed significantly affects user experience and search engine rankings. Slow-loading pages frustrate visitors and lead to higher bounce rates. Google considers page speed as a ranking factor, so optimizing your site for faster load times is crucial.
-
Why is mobile friendliness essential for SEO?
Mobile devices account for a substantial portion of web traffic. Google prioritizes mobile-friendly websites in its search results. A responsive design ensures that your site adapts seamlessly to various screen sizes, enhancing user experience and search visibility.
-
How can I address duplicate content issues?
Duplicate content can harm your SEO efforts. Use canonical tags to indicate the preferred version of a page when similar content exists across multiple URLs. Additionally, regularly audit your site to identify and rectify duplicate content.
-
What role does structured data play in SEO?
Structured data (implemented through schema markup) provides context to search engines about your content. It enhances rich snippets in search results, improving click-through rates. Properly implemented structured data can positively impact your SEO performance.